Realme 9 vs. Xiaomi Poco M4 5G: A Deep Dive
Let's dissect the Realme 9 and Xiaomi Poco M4 5G, going beyond the spec sheet to uncover what these phones truly offer in the real world.

2. Key Insights
- Display: The Realme 9's AMOLED display is a clear winner, providing vibrant colors and deep blacks that the Poco M4 5G's IPS LCD can't match. The higher brightness on the Realme 9 is a significant advantage for outdoor use.
- Performance: While the Dimensity 700 in the Poco M4 5G boasts a higher Antutu score and 5G capability, the Realme 9's Snapdragon 680 combined with larger RAM options could deliver a smoother everyday experience for many users. It's a classic "benchmark vs. real-world" scenario.
- Camera: The Realme 9's 108MP main sensor aims for detail, while the Poco M4 5G focuses on features like portrait mode. Image quality will depend heavily on software processing, requiring further real-world testing beyond the spec sheet.
- Battery and Charging: Both phones have similar battery capacities, but the Realme 9's significantly faster 33W charging gives it a clear edge in convenience.
- Overall Feel: The Realme 9 feels noticeably more premium in hand due to its lighter weight and slimmer profile.
3. User Profiles and Recommendations
- Realme 9: Best suited for users who prioritize display quality, a comfortable in-hand feel, faster charging, and strong everyday performance. Ideal for media consumption, social media, and casual gaming.
- Xiaomi Poco M4 5G: Best for budget-conscious users who need 5G connectivity and prioritize raw processing power for demanding tasks or gaming.
